1958 major college football rankings
Two human polls comprised the 1958 NCAA University Division football rankings. Unlike most sports, college football's governing body, the NCAA, does not bestow a national championship, instead that title is bestowed by one or more different polling agencies. There are two main weekly polls that begin in the preseason—the AP Poll and the Coaches Poll.

AP poll
The final AP poll was released on December 1, at the end of the 1958 regular season, weeks before the major bowls. The AP would not release a post-bowl season final poll regularly until 1968.
Final Coaches Poll
The final UPI Coaches Poll was released prior to the bowl games, on December 1. LSU received 29 of the 35 first-place votes; Iowa received four, and one each went to Army and Air Force.
Litkenhous Ratings
The final Litkenhous Ratings, released in December 1958, ranked over 650 teams. The top 50 teams as ranked by Litkenhous were:
- LSU
- Army
- Oklahoma
- Iowa
- Wisconsin
- Ole Miss
- Syracuse
- Purdue
- TCU
- Ohio State
- Northwestern
- SMU
- Auburn
- Notre Dame
- Rice
- Georgia
- Florida
- Penn State
- Illinois
- Air Force
- Pittsburgh
- Texas
- North Carolina
- Vanderbilt
- Alabama
- Washington State
- Kentucky
- Georgia Tech
- Mississippi Southern
- Arkansas
- Oregon
- Michigan State
- Oklahoma State
- Mississippi State
- Houston
- South Carolina
- Trinity (TX)
- USC
- Minnesota
- West Virginia
- Florida State
- Duke
- Navy
- Tulsa
- Colorado
- Tennessee
- Texas East
- Missouri
- Indiana
- California
